Philippines Geothermal Greenfield Due Diligence

Philippines Geothermal Greenfield Due Diligence

JRG Energy conducted a due diligence assessment of a geothermal greenfield opportunity for INPEX in the Philippines. The scope encompassed a comprehensive literature review, fieldwork including fluid sampling and chemical analysis, geochemical modelling of thermal manifestations, review of magnetotelluric and gravity geophysical surveys, and recommendations for further assessments to advance the project towards a development decision.

Cesano Geothermal Lithium Scoping Study

JRG Energy provided reservoir input to Altamin’s scoping study for a geothermal lithium project at Cesano. The scope included a review of legacy data, estimation of well output and resource longevity, and delivery of a concise technical report chapter suitable for inclusion in the scoping study. Gingerah Geothermal Pre-feasibility Study

JRG Energy delivered a pre-feasibility study for the Gingerah Geothermal(GEP-47) project, integrating geological, structural, hydrogeological, and geothermal reservoir data into a 3D conceptual model. Temperature modelling was performed using the Waiwera geothermal simulator, and an initial resource assessment evaluated viability for power generation using EGS technology. The study also benchmarked the project against comparable global projects and identified potential investors and off-takers.
